This weekend, the race for 4th place and the final Champions League spot went from 4 teams down to 2. Liverpool and Villa both lost to Chelsea and Manchester City, respectively, mathematically eliminating them from 4th place. With 2 games left to play, the 4th place spot will either go to Tottenham or Manchester City. To top it off, these two teams play each other on Wednesday before the season ends this weekend.
As I expected when it was announced, the game on Wednesday will probably decide who gets 4th place. If Spurs win, it's over. If the game ends in a draw or a City win, 4th place will be decided this weekend. However, a draw would still probably require a Spurs win on the weekend while a City win would all but clinch 4th since they would probably just need to draw their final game unless Spurs win big (4 or 5) in their final game. I expect a draw, but you just never know with City or Spurs. City aren't consistent even though they've been playing well lately and Tottenham have historically found a way to lose when it matters most, usually in a heartbreaking manner. However, this season has been different for Spurs.
Neither team has ever played in the Champions League, so this game will be huge, both progressively and financially speaking.
